Basupur

Basupur is a village located in Mehnagar tehsil of Azamgarh district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 5km away from sub-district headquarter Mehnagar (tehsildar office) and 38km away from district headquarter Azamgarh. As per 2009 stats, Basupur village is also a gram panchayat.

About Basupur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Basupur is 195829. The village spans a total geographical area of 234.82 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 276204. Mehnagar is nearest town to Basupur village for all major economic activities.

Population of Basupur

According to the 2011 Census, Basupur has a total population of about 2,266, with approximately 1,108 males and 1,158 females. The sex ratio is around 1045 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 309 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 595 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 57.33%, with male literacy at about 67.24% and female literacy near 47.84%. There are around 292 households in the village. Connectivity of Basupur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Basupur. As per the 2011 stats, Basupur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
